Today’s Most Exciting Headline: “Missy Elliott And Timbaland To Drop Solo LPs”

For certain people, this is more exciting than the Grammys, “Glory,” Beyonce in public and the Born This Way stage set combined.
Missy was last seen, depending on how deeply into pop you look, on Katy Perry’s “Last Friday Night (T.G.We’ve Got People Willing To Throw A Verse Onto A Remix Still),” J. Cole’s “Nobody’s Perfect” or Demi Lovato’s “All Night Long.” The latter had Timbaland, too, who’s had a few more guest appearances but nothing near as glorious as a few years ago. (A few years ago meaning before Shock Value II, thank you.)

The plan for 2012, now, is for Timbaland (who might be talking about Shock Value III) and Missy to release solo albums in June simultaneously. Details are scant, but nevertheless, Timbaland told MTV News:

“Right now, we’re preparing to get both our videos, our first singles, shot kinda at the same time. We want to do it as a movement and spontaneously.

We don’t seriously have to tell you why this is promising, do we? We’re all in agreement that we don’t have to write a couple hundred words on why Missy and Timbaland are awesome separately and in tandem, yes? Good.
